20in12 aims to provide a direct link for all schools and settings with the National 2012 Educational Programme ‘GET SET’ to ensure as many Kent schools and settings become accredited members of the ‘GET SET NETWORK’, which will result in them receiving many enhanced benefits for their students in the build up to the London Games in the summer of 2012.
The “GET SET” programme is based on learning activities linked directly with the 7 Olympic and Paralympic values. In Kent, we have placed the 7 values into the following order to show PRIDE.

The first orientation training event for London 2012 Games Maker volunteers and Games-time employees took place today at Wembley Arena in London.
The deadline has been extended for businesses to apply for permission to trade or advertise near London 2012 Olympic and Paralympic venues.
The London 2012 Organising Committee (LOCOG) has announced details of the lighting of the Olympic Flame and its arrival into the UK on the 18 May.
The London 2012 Organising Committee (LOCOG) has today confirmed that Egypt has joined the London 2012 legacy programme International Inspiration, becoming the 20th and final country to do so.
The London 2012 Organising Committee (LOCOG) has today revealed a world-class line-up for the UCI Track Cycling World Cup, presented by Samsung, which takes place on 16-19 February 2012.
The London 2012 Organising Committee (LOCOG) today announced that the under 16s Volunteer Performer Cast for the Olympic and Paralympic Ceremonies will be selected from schools in the six east London Host Boroughs.
With exactly six months to go until the London 2012 Games, the Olympic Delivery Authority (ODA) will today hand over the Olympic and Paralympic Village site to the London 2012 Organising Committee (LOCOG).
The Olympic Park’s artist in residence, Neville Gabie, has created his own version of the ‘Bathers at Asnieres’ as part of the Olympic Delivery Authority's (ODA's) Art in the Park programme.
The London 2012 Organising Committee has announced that up to 15,000 spectators will be able to enjoy one of the best vantage points on the Olympic Cycling Road Race route, up from an original 3,500.
London 2012 has announced plans for schoolchildren across the UK to take part in sporting and cultural activities for World Sport Day, presented by Lloyds TSB on 25 June.
